Scout Traveler vs Volvo EX90: Which Should You Buy?

The Scout Traveler starts at $57,500, undercutting the Volvo EX90 ($81,290) by about $24,000.

In its longest-range configuration the Scout Traveler covers 350 miles, 50 more than the Volvo EX90's 300.

The Volvo EX90 seats 7 to the Scout Traveler's 6. The Volvo EX90 is also 10 inches shorter than the Scout Traveler, which makes it easier to park.

Bottom line: pick the Scout Traveler if you tow, or the Volvo EX90 if you need room for the whole crew.
